The butcher's shop is used to butcher Template:L. Tame animals can be designated for butchering either by pressing 'v', moving the curser over the animal and pressing 's', or by going into the animal list by pressing 'z', 'Enter' and then by choosing the animal(s) for butchering by pressing 'b' while they are highlighted.

A butcher's shop is operated by any dwarf with the 'butchery' Template:L enabled.
